Polydimethylsiloxane PDMS , also known as dimethylpolysiloxane or dimethicone , is a silicone polymer with a wide variety of uses, from cosmetics to industrial lubrication. It is particularly known for its unusual rheological or flow properties. PDMS is optically clear and, in general, inert , non-toxic , and non-flammable. It is one of several types of silicone oil polymerized siloxane. Its applications range from contact lenses and medical devices to elastomers ; it is also present in shampoos as it makes hair shiny and slippery , food antifoaming agent , caulk , lubricants and heat-resistant tiles. For medical and domestic applications, a process was developed in which the chlorine atoms in the silane precursor were replaced with acetate groups. In this case, the polymerization produces acetic acid , which is less chemically aggressive than HCl. As a side-effect, the curing process is also much slower in this case. The acetate is used in consumer applications, such as silicone caulk and adhesives. Silane precursors with more acid-forming groups and fewer methyl groups, such as methyltrichlorosilane , can be used to introduce branches or cross-links in the polymer chain. Under ideal conditions, each molecule of such a compound becomes a branch point. This can be used to produce hard silicone resins. In a similar manner, precursors with three methyl groups can be used to limit molecular weight, since each such molecule has only one reactive site and so forms the end of a siloxane chain.
